在数字化转型加速的2026年,软件质量已成为企业核心竞争力。据Gartner统计,低效质量管控导致企业年均损失$260万。当前测试团队普遍面临三大痛点:碎片化指标无法反映真实质量水位(如仅关注缺陷数量忽视严重度)、度量数据与改进动作脱节、缺乏端到端可观测性体系。高效度量体系的本质是通过数据驱动,将质量管控从被动救火转向主动预防。
一、构建四维度量框架:平衡量化与价值
1.1 质量健康度指标体系
可靠性维度:
线上故障率(<0.1%达标)
平均故障恢复时间(MTTR)分层监控(P0级<15分钟)
缺陷逃逸率(生产环境缺陷/测试发现缺陷)
用户体验维度:
关键路径成功率(支付/登录>99.95%)
性能衰减指数(版本迭代后响应时间波动≤5%)
效能维度:
自动化测试有效性(用例失败精准率≥85%)
需求覆盖度(追溯每个需求到测试用例)
1.2 数据采集技术栈
graph LR A[代码仓库] -->|SonarQube| B(静态质量门禁) C[测试平台] -->|Xray/Jira| D(缺陷模式分析) E[生产环境] -->|Prometheus/Grafana| F(实时质量仪表盘) B --> G[统一度量中枢] D --> G F --> G二、实施五步落地法则
2.1 目标对齐(Goal Setting)
采用WSJF加权模型确定优先级:业务价值×用户影响×质量风险 / 实施成本
案例:某金融APP将“支付成功率”权重设为0.6,因1%下跌导致日均损失$50万
2.2 智能诊断(Smart Diagnosis)
建立缺陷预测模型:
# 基于代码复杂度/历史缺陷的预测示例 def predict_defect(code_complexity, change_frequency): risk_score = 0.4*complexity + 0.6*change_freq return "高危" if risk_score > 7 else "中低危"测试用例智能推荐:通过代码变更关联影响范围分析
2.3 闭环改进(Closed-loop Optimization)
flowchart TD A[度量数据] --> B{异常定位} B -->|性能瓶颈| C[压测优化] B -->|逻辑缺陷| D[用例强化] C --> E[基线阈值提升20%] D --> F[缺陷检出率+35%]三、避开三大实施陷阱
虚荣指标陷阱
× 总测试用例数 → √ 有效缺陷发现率
某电商团队将用例数从5000减至1200关键用例,缺陷捕获率反升22%数据孤岛陷阱
建立质量数据湖,整合研发流水线(Jenkins)、监控系统(ELK)、用户反馈(NPS)过度度量陷阱
采用“3-5-7原则”:团队级关注3个核心指标
项目级深化5个维度
高管层呈现7页摘要报告
四、2026年技术前瞻
AI驱动的质量预测
LSTM模型预判版本风险(准确率达89%)元宇宙测试度量
虚拟用户行为轨迹热力图分析区块链质量存证
测试结果上链确保审计可追溯
某智能驾驶团队通过实时度量体系,将OTA升级故障率从1.2%降至0.08%
精选文章
质量目标的智能对齐:软件测试从业者的智能时代实践指南
意识模型的测试可能性:从理论到实践的软件测试新范式
构建软件测试中的伦理风险识别与评估体系
算法偏见的检测方法:软件测试的实践指南